Optical depths and vertical profiles of stratospheric aerosol based on multi-year polarization measurements of the twilight sky

The method of detection of light scattering on stratospheric aerosol particles on the twilight sky background is considered. It is based on the data on sky intensity and polarization in the solar vertical at zenith distances of up to 50 degrees from the sunset fill the moment of the Sun depression to 8 degrees below the horizon. The measurements conducted in central Russia since 2011 had shown the negative trend of stratospheric aerosol content, this can be related with the relaxation of the stratosphere after the number of volcanic eruptions during the first decade of XXI century.
